Dediée a Son Altesse Royale Monseigneur l'Archiduc Pierre Leopold... Par Son très humble et très Soumis Serviteur Ja. Ph. Hackert. [&] II.eme Vue de Livourne... [&] III.eme Vue de Livourne... [&] IV.eme Vue de Livourne....
Peint par Ja. Ph. Hackert. 1778. Grave a l'eau forte par B.A. Dunker et termine par G. Eichler.
A Rome chez George Hackert Graveur Place d'Espagne.
Set of four etchings with engraving. 345 x 480mm (13½ x 19") very large margins.
A rare set of matching four views of Livorno, an important free port in Tuscany, known to the British as 'Leghorn', showing it as a bustling port filled with ships. The second plate illustrates the famous 'Monument of the Four Moors', decorated with four bronze slaves. The third has portrait of an Ottoman merchant with women and wares on the quayside. The fourth has a storm and shipwreck, with people being pulled from the sea onto the shore. After Jacob Philipp Hackert (1737 - 1807), painter and etcher. Born in Prenzlau north of Berlin, he came to Italy in 1768, settling first in Rome and (from 1787) Naples.
